Abstract: In daily life Speech and spoken words have always played a big role in the individual and collective lives of the people. The Speech that represents the spoken form of a language. Speech synthesis is the process of converting message written in text to equivalent message in spoken form. A Text-To-Speech (TTS) synthesizer as a computer-based system that should be able to read text. In this paper, I am explaining single text-to-speech (TTS) system for Indian languages Viz. , Hindi to generate speech. This generally involves two steps, text processing and speech generation. A graphical user interface has been designed for converting Hindi text to speech in Java Swings. In India there are different languages are spoken, but each language is the mother tongue of tens of millions of people. The languages and scripts are very different from each other. The grammar and the alphabet words are similar to a large extent. This paper present text-to-speech (TTS) system based on the Concatenative synthesis approach.
